Our plant expert Peter Hiscock, shows you how to add an extra dimension to your aquarium with a mist maker. A good way to add an extra dimension to a planted tank is to grow some plants above the water's surface. Many aquarium plants grow above the water's surface in nature and most are in fact not "true" aquatic plants anyway. The problem with growing plants above the surface in aquaria is that the heat produced by the lights creates a hot, dry area where most plants simply wither and die. Althoughsome plants do produce leaves suited to life above water, these leaves are still not as effective at holding water to prevent drying as those of terrestrial plants. In some aquaria it may be possible to have an open hood, allowing good ventilation and removing the hot, dry air. Light units can then be suspended at least 4ocm above the water's surface, allowing plenty of room to grow plants above the water. In aquaria where this is not possible, the ideal solution is to create an artificially humid environment and one of the best ways to do this is to purchase a mist generator. These devices are gaining popularity and are now easily available and often sold for water features or reptile aquaria. The visual effect of a mist generator is also quite magical and creates an eerie swamp feel to the aquarium. Plants such as Anubias, Java Moss, Hydrocotyle sp., Ophiopogon sp., and also many pond marginals make ideal above water plants for the aquarium.
